SEABORN HEALTH CARE INC Government Contract #15B40126F00000074

SEABORN HEALTH CARE INC was awarded a contract with the United States Government for $2,630.20. The contract was awarded by the agency office MCC CHICAGO, which is a division with the Federal Prison System / Bureau of Prisons within the Department of Justice.

Summary of Award

SEABORN HEALTH CARE INC is the recipient of a government contract for pharmacist services at MCC CHICAGO. The Department of Justice, specifically the Federal Prison System, funded the contract for a total of $2630.2. Notable transactions include a single transaction amounting to $2630.2 on February 27, 2026.
